Why Do My Pipes Make Noises
To identify noisy plumbing, it is important to determine initial whether the undesirable sounds take place on the system's inlet side-in various other words, when water is turned on-or on the drain side. Sounds on the inlet side have actually varied reasons: too much water pressure, worn shutoff as well as faucet parts, poorly linked pumps or other devices, inaccurately put pipe bolts, as well as plumbing runs containing way too many limited bends or other constraints. Noises on the drain side generally originate from bad location or, similar to some inlet side noise, a layout consisting of tight bends.

Hissing


Hissing sound that happens when a faucet is opened a little typically signals excessive water stress. Consult your local public utility if you think this problem; it will certainly be able to inform you the water pressure in your location as well as can mount a pressurereducing valve on the incoming water system pipe if essential.

Other Inlet Side Noises


Squeaking, squeaking, damaging, snapping, and also tapping generally are triggered by the development or contraction of pipelines, typically copper ones providing hot water. The audios occur as the pipelines slide against loosened fasteners or strike close-by house framing. You can often identify the area of the issue if the pipelines are exposed; simply follow the noise when the pipes are making sounds. Most likely you will certainly discover a loose pipeline hanger or a location where pipelines lie so near to floor joists or other mounting pieces that they clatter against them. Affixing foam pipe insulation around the pipes at the point of call should correct the trouble. Be sure bands and also wall mounts are secure as well as supply ample assistance. Where feasible, pipe fasteners ought to be connected to substantial structural elements such as foundation wall surfaces as opposed to to mounting; doing so decreases the transmission of vibrations from plumbing to surfaces that can enhance as well as transfer them. If connecting bolts to framework is inescapable, cover pipelines with insulation or various other resistant material where they get in touch with bolts, and also sandwich completions of new fasteners between rubber washing machines when mounting them.
Dealing with plumbing runs that suffer from flow-restricting tight or numerous bends is a last option that ought to be carried out only after seeking advice from a competent plumbing professional. Sadly, this circumstance is relatively common in older houses that might not have actually been constructed with interior plumbing or that have actually seen numerous remodels, especially by amateurs.

Chattering or Screeching


Intense chattering or screeching that occurs when a valve or faucet is turned on, which generally goes away when the installation is opened completely, signals loose or defective inner components. The option is to change the valve or faucet with a brand-new one.
Pumps and appliances such as washing machines and dishwashers can transfer electric motor sound to pipelines if they are incorrectly linked. Link such products to plumbing with plastic or rubber hoses-never stiff pipe-to isolate them.

Drainpipe Noise


On the drain side of plumbing, the principal objectives are to get rid of surface areas that can be struck by falling or hurrying water and also to shield pipelines to include unavoidable sounds.
In brand-new building and construction, bath tubs, shower stalls, bathrooms, as well as wallmounted sinks and basins need to be set on or versus durable underlayments to decrease the transmission of sound via them. Water-saving commodes as well as faucets are less loud than standard designs; install them instead of older kinds even if codes in your area still permit making use of older components.
Drainpipes that do not run up and down to the cellar or that branch into straight pipe runs sustained at flooring joists or other mounting present specifically bothersome noise issues. Such pipes are huge enough to radiate substantial resonance; they also bring significant quantities of water, which makes the scenario worse. In brand-new construction, define cast-iron soil pipelines (the huge pipes that drain pipes bathrooms) if you can afford them. Their enormity includes much of the sound made by water passing through them. Additionally, prevent routing drains in walls shared with bedrooms as well as areas where people collect. Walls containing drains should be soundproofed as was defined earlier, making use of double panels of sound-insulating fiber board as well as wallboard. Pipelines themselves can be wrapped with special fiberglass insulation created the purpose; such pipes have a resistant vinyl skin (often containing lead). Results are not constantly satisfactory.

Thudding


Thudding noise, usually accompanied by shivering pipes, when a tap or appliance valve is switched off is a condition called water hammer. The sound and resonance are caused by the reverberating wave of stress in the water, which all of a sudden has no area to go. Sometimes opening a shutoff that discharges water swiftly right into a section of piping consisting of a restriction, arm joint, or tee installation can produce the exact same problem.
Water hammer can usually be treated by setting up installations called air chambers or shock absorbers in the plumbing to which the trouble valves or faucets are linked. These tools permit the shock wave created by the halted flow of water to dissipate in the air they include, which (unlike water) is compressible.
Older plumbing systems might have brief upright sections of capped pipeline behind wall surfaces on faucet runs for the very same objective; these can eventually full of water, lowering or damaging their effectiveness. The remedy is to drain pipes the water supply completely by shutting off the primary water system shutoff and opening all faucets. After that open up the major supply valve and close the faucets one by one, beginning with the tap nearest the shutoff as well as finishing with the one farthest away.

WHY IS MY PLUMBING MAKING SO MUCH NOISE?


This noise indeed sounds like someone is banging a hammer against your pipes! It happens when a faucet is opened, allowed to run for a bit, then quickly shut — causing the rushing water to slam against the shut-off valve.



To remedy this, you’ll need to check and refill your air chamber. Air chambers are filled with — you guessed it — air and help absorb the shock of moving water (that comes to a sudden stop). Over time, these chambers can fill with water, making them less effective.

Cracks or Ticks


Cracking or ticking typically comes from hot water going through cold, copper pipes. This causes the copper to expand resulting in a cracking or ticking sound. Once the pipes stop expanding, the noise should stop as well.



Pro tip: you may want to lower the temperature of your water heater to see if that helps lessen the sound, or wrapping the pipe in insulation can also help muffle the noise.


Bangs


Bangs typically come from water pressure that’s too high. To test for high water pressure, get a pressure gauge and attach it to your faucet. Water pressure should be no higher than 80 psi (pounds per square inch) and also no lower than 40 psi. If you find a number greater than 80 psi, then you’ve found your problem!
